Pep Guardiola Secures Fifth Premier League Manager Of The Season Title

Pep Guardiola has been named Premier League Manager of the Season for the fifth time after leading Manchester City to a fourth consecutive title. City edged out Arsenal by two points on the final day of the season to win their eighth Premier League title, their sixth under Guardiola.

They are the first team in English football history to win more than three consecutive titles. Guardiola is just the fourth manager to win six English top-flight crowns. Alex Ferguson leads with 13, while Guardiola has matched former Aston Villa manager George Ramsay and Liverpool legend Bob Paisley.

Guardiola Wins Fifth Manager Award

With 11, Ferguson is also the only person to win the Premier League Manager of the Season award more often than Guardiola. This fifth award places Guardiola further ahead of Jose Mourinho and Arsene Wenger, who have three each. Guardiola previously claimed the prize after title-winning campaigns in 2017-18, 2018-19, 2020-21, and 2022-23.

Having seen off competition from four other nominees, Guardiola said they deserved to share the honour with him. "I want to share it, especially with Mikel [Arteta] for the incredible job he has done until the last game, bringing us to our limits," said Guardiola.

"Of course, for Jurgen [Klopp], for the unforgettable battles for many, many years. And Unai Emery, making something unbelievable again to bring Aston Villa to the Champions League. And Andoni Iraola, with Bournemouth, being his first season in the Premier League, doing what he has done and coming back from a tough start to the season."

"It is an honour to be alongside all of them and to win this trophy. We will defend this award as best as possible in the future," he added.

Guardiola's achievements place him among an elite group of managers in English football history. His six titles with Manchester City are a testament to his consistent success and tactical acumen. The comparison with legends like Ferguson, Ramsay, and Paisley underscores his significant impact on the sport.

Manchester City's dominance under Guardiola has set new benchmarks in English football. Their ability to maintain high performance levels over multiple seasons highlights their resilience and strategic planning.

Future Prospects

As Manchester City continues to build on its successes, Guardiola's leadership will be crucial in navigating future challenges. The team's recent achievements have raised expectations for continued excellence in domestic and international competitions.

The recognition of Guardiola's managerial prowess not only celebrates his past accomplishments but also sets a high bar for future endeavours. His commitment to sharing credit with fellow managers reflects a sportsmanship that enhances his standing in the football community.
